Publication number: 20260037700Abstract: Validating a simulation scenario for use in training a machine learning model for an autonomous vehicle includes determining a simulation scenario; executing a simulation based on a simulation scenario; monitoring execution of the simulation and receiving messages from the execution of the simulation; determining, by a first simulation monitor, whether the messages satisfy a first incident; and validating the simulation scenario responsive to the messages satisfying the first incident to produce validated simulation data. A system and method may also include determining, by a first simulation validator, whether the messages satisfy a condition; and validating the simulation scenario responsive to the messages satisfying the condition to produce validated simulation data.Type: ApplicationFiled: October 15, 2025Publication date: February 5, 2026Inventors: Simon Box, Clinton Wade Liddick, John Michael Wyrwas

Patent number: 12367086Abstract: Logged data from an autonomous vehicle is processed to generate augmented data. The augmented data describes an actor in an environment of the autonomous vehicle, the actor having an associated actor type and an actor motion behavior characteristic. The augmented data may be varied to create different sets of augmented data. The sets of augmented data can be used to create one or more simulation scenarios that in turn are used to produce machine learning models to control the operation of autonomous vehicles.Type: GrantFiled: December 11, 2020Date of Patent: July 22, 2025Assignee: Aurora Operations, Inc.Inventors: John Michael Wyrwas, Jessica Elizabeth Smith, Simon Box

Publication number: 20250111105Abstract: Simulation data of the autonomous vehicle is processed by executing a simulation based on the simulation data to generate a simulation result. Then a perception scenario is generated from the simulation result. The generated perception scenario is validated by verifying whether a constraint is satisfied to produce a validated perception scenario. The validated perception scenario can be used to create or refine a perception model used for controlling the operation of autonomous vehicles.Type: ApplicationFiled: December 12, 2024Publication date: April 3, 2025Inventors: Steven Capell, Simon Box, John Michael Wyrwas

Publication number: 20250042923Abstract: The current invention relates to a method for the production of at least one organometallic compound comprising: filling solid metal particulates or metal containing solid particulates into a reactor column obtaining a metal bed; continuously contacting a fluid of at least one substrate, preferably the fluid comprises a water-free solvent, with the metal bed; transporting the fluid against gravity through the metal bed, characterized in that, the fluid is partially recirculated again over the metal bed. The invention also relates to a device for the production of at least one organometallic compound, the organometallic compound itself and chemical substances produced from said compound.Type: ApplicationFiled: February 10, 2023Publication date: February 6, 2025Applicant: CHEMIUM SRLInventors: Luc REGINSTER, Bernard SIMONS, Simon BOX, Marc LACROIX, Vincent MUTTERER

Publication number: 20150002315Abstract: A method for state estimation of a road network includes at least the steps of gathering information from at least two sensors, wherein at least one of the sensors detects radio signals, combining the information from the at least two sensors using an extended Kalman filter, and determining at least one state in a discretized road network using the combined information.Type: ApplicationFiled: January 28, 2013Publication date: January 1, 2015Inventors: Simon Box, Benedict Waterson

Publication number: 20140339486Abstract: A security barrier (10) comprises a first fence (20) and a second fence (40). The first fence comprises a first series of posts (22) and the second fence comprises a second series of posts (42). The first and second fences are provided adjacent to each other with the first fence being coupled below ground level with a the second fence. A footing having first and second post sockets is also provided for receiving a first post from each of the first and second fences respectively.Type: ApplicationFiled: August 6, 2012Publication date: November 20, 2014Applicant: Hill & Smith LimitedInventors: Graham Sharp, Simon Box
